Hackers target WordPress sites in miniOrange auth bypass attacks
BleepingComputer·August 24, 2026·1 min read
Hackers are actively exploiting two critical authentication bypass vulnerabilities in the miniOrange SAML 2.0 Single Sign On plugin for WordPress, which can allow attackers to forge SAML responses and log in as administrators. The warnings highlight the urgent need for WordPress site administrators to patch the plugin immediately to prevent unauthorized access.
